Road Trip Time: Columbus, Ohio to Dunnellon, Florida

If you're planning a road trip from Columbus, Ohio to Dunnellon, Florida, you're in for a great adventure! There are a few different routes you can take, each with its own unique charm and scenery. Whether you're in a rush or looking to make a few pit stops along the way, we've got you covered with the best routes and travel times.

Route 1: The Direct Route

The most direct route from Columbus to Dunnellon is via I-71S and I-75S, spanning a distance of approximately 800 miles. If you're looking to make good time and minimize stops, this is the route for you. With minimal traffic, you can expect to cover the distance in around 11-12 hours of driving.

Consider making a pit stop in beautiful Chattanooga, Tennessee, nestled at the foothills of the Appalachian Mountains. With its stunning views and outdoor activities, it's a great place to stretch your legs and take in some fresh air.

Route 2: Scenic Route via the Smokies

For those seeking a more scenic drive, consider taking I-71S, I-75S, and I-40E, adding about an hour to your travel time. This route takes you through the Great Smoky Mountains, offering breathtaking views and the opportunity to explore the charming towns along the way.

With this route, you can plan for approximately 12-13 hours of driving time. Consider stopping in Asheville, North Carolina, a vibrant city known for its arts, music, and craft beer scene.

Route 3: Coastal Route via Savannah

If you're up for a slightly longer but more leisurely drive, take I-71S, I-75S, and I-16E, adding another 30-60 minutes to your travel time. This route takes you through the enchanting city of Savannah, Georgia, with its historic architecture and southern hospitality.

With this route, you can expect to spend about 13-14 hours on the road. Savannah is the perfect place to stop and explore its charming squares, vibrant waterfront, and delicious southern cuisine.

No matter which route you choose, be sure to plan for rest stops and meal breaks along the way. Safe travels and enjoy the journey!
